Why did Hamilton want to add to the national debt

History
2 answers:
QveST [7]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

He wanted to to pay off both the federal and states war debt

Explanation:

He suggested that the debt be funded by reissuing bonds to be paid back in full after 15 or 20 years. There for, rather than eliminating the debt, Hamilton's plan created a large, permanent public debt, issuing new bonds as old ones were paid off. Congress approved this proposal shortly afterword.

Who were the committee of correspondence? how were they seen as a shadow government?
Andreas93 [3]
The committees of correspondence were shadow governments organized by the Patriot leaders of the Thirteen Colonies on the eve of the American Revolution. They coordinated responses to England and shared their plans; by 1773 they had emerged as shadow governments, superseding the colonial legislature and royal officials. The Maryland Committee of Correspondence was instrumental in setting up the First Continental Congress, which met in Philadelphia. These served an important role in the Revolution, by disseminating the colonial interpretation of British actions between the colonies and to foreign governments. The committees of correspondence rallied opposition on common causes and established plans for collective action, and so the group of committees was the beginning of what later became a formal political union among the colonies.
